Improper input validation in macOS - CVE-2018-4240

 

Improper input validation in macOS - CVE-2018-4240

Published: June 4, 2018 / Updated: June 17, 2021


Vulnerability identifier: #VU13159
CSH Severity: Medium
CVSS v4: 8.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
CVE-ID: CVE-2018-4240
CWE-ID: CWE-20
Exploitation vector: Remote access
Exploit availability: Public exploit is available

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ause DoS condition on the target system.

The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of user-supplied input.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ted message and cause the service to crash.


Affected software

macOS
watchOS
tvOS
Apple iOS
IBM Watson Explorer Deep Analytics Edition Analytical Components

How to mitigate CVE-2018-4240

Update to version 10.13.4.

IBM Watson Explorer Deep Analytics Edition Analytical Components - update to 12.0.3.16
